Longitudinal effects of gender-affirming hormone therapy on the brain (2026)

A multicenter longitudinal study presented in early 2026 analyzes the structural brain changes during the first six months of gender-affirming hormone therapy in a sample of 43 transgender people. The work is available as a preprint and is undergoing peer review.

Study design

The participants underwent two magnetic resonance imaging scans: one at baseline and another at six months of treatment. Changes in the volume and morphology of brain regions sensitive to sex hormones, such as the amygdala, the hippocampus and the cerebral cortex, were assessed.

Preliminary observations

The preliminary results point to structural modifications that vary according to the treatment (estrogens with or without antiandrogens, and testosterone), although the authors insist that these are initial findings that must be confirmed after scientific review and with larger samples.

This type of longitudinal study is essential to understand how hormones influence the brain of transgender people and to separate the effects of treatment from the characteristics preceding therapy.

Bibliographic reference: Hüpen P. et al. Longitudinal effects of gender-affirming hormone therapy on brain structure. Preprint, SSRN, January 2026. DOI: 10.2139/ssrn.6139319.
